North American Hockey League

The North American Hockey League (NAHL) is a junior A league founded in 1975. As of June 2000, the League had 11 member teams. Each team plays a 56-game regular-season schedule beginning in September and culminating in April, with exhibition games and league playoff games providing additional contests. The NAHL's primary goal is to enhance the development of its players through top-quality coaching, extensive practice time and a rigorous game schedule.
